在桌面保存网络日志是许多用户在进行系统调试、网络故障排查或安全分析时的重要需求。网络日志包含了访问网站的记录、IP地址、请求时间、响应状态等信息,有助于追踪用户行为、分析流量模式或排查潜在的安全问题。以下是几种在桌面保存网络日志的方法,适用于不同操作系统和使用场景。
对于Windows系统用户,可以使用“Internet Explorer”或“Edge”浏览器的开发者工具来查看和保存网络请求日志。打开浏览器,按下F12键进入开发者模式,选择“Network”标签页,刷新页面后即可看到所有网络请求的详细信息。点击任意请求,可以查看其请求头、响应头、请求体和响应内容。用户可以右键点击某个请求,选择“Save as HAR with content”来保存为HAR格式文件,便于后续分析。

此外,Windows系统自带的“事件查看器”也可以用来记录网络相关的日志。打开“事件查看器”,在“Windows日志”下选择“系统”或“安全”日志,找到与网络活动相关的事件,右键点击事件并选择“保存为XML文件”即可。这种方法适合需要记录系统级网络事件的用户,如网络连接状态、防火墙规则变更等。
对于Mac用户,可以使用“Safari”浏览器的开发者工具来保存网络日志。打开Safari,进入“开发”菜单,选择“显示JavaScript控制台”,然后在控制台中输入“console.log(window.performance.getEntries())”来获取网络请求的详细信息。用户还可以使用第三方工具如“Charles Proxy”或“Wireshark”来捕获和保存网络流量数据。这些工具提供了更强大的功能,如过滤请求、分析协议、监控HTTPS流量等,适合高级用户使用。
Linux用户可以使用“curl”命令来保存网络请求日志。在终端中输入“curl -v [URL]”命令,可以查看请求和响应的详细信息。用户可以通过重定向输出到文件来保存日志,例如“curl -v [URL] > network_log.txt”。此外,还可以使用“tcpdump”或“Wireshark”等工具来捕获网络流量,这些工具可以记录所有通过网络接口的数据包,包括HTTP请求和响应。
无论使用哪种方法,保存网络日志时都需要注意隐私和安全问题。日志中可能包含敏感信息,如个人身份信息、密码等,因此应确保日志文件的安全存储和访问权限。同时,保存日志时应遵守相关法律法规,如《个人信息保护法》等,避免侵犯他人隐私或违反网络安全规定。

总之,保存网络日志是网络分析和故障排查的重要步骤。通过使用浏览器开发者工具、系统日志功能或第三方工具,用户可以有效地记录和分析网络活动。在保存日志时,应注重隐私保护和数据安全,确保日志的合法性和合规性。